Colin Deleger

In 1987, Michel Colin, the third generation of his family to make wines in Chassagne-Montrachet, was given part of the Chenevottes acreage by his uncle, the highly respected Georges Deleger. He has since been making Chassagne-Montrachet wines under his own name, producing distinguished wines with a great deal of fruit and complexity. This is one of the best domaines in the village; which keeps yields controlled and vinification traditional. All the wines, including the white Premiers Crus are bottled relatively early so they retain their freshness and natural acidity. The white wines from this domaine are rich but perfectly balanced with crisp underlying acidity. Michel has handed over responsibility for the red winemaking to his eldest son Philippe who, without doubt has been responsible for a great improvement in quality.
